Steinhoff orders 67 new Dafs from Asset Alliance

Furniture retailer Steinhoff - owner of Bensons for Beds and Harveys - has ordered 67 new Dafs with Martin Williams de-mountable bodies from Asset Alliance on five-year full service agreements.

Steinhoff’s order includes 10 Daf LF 260 12-tonners, now based in Lutterworth on 24-hour trunking duties, and 57 Daf LF 160 7.5-tonne trucks for the home delivery fleet, based in Accrington, Dagenham, Dublin, Huntingdon, Lutterworth and Warrington. Each vehicle in the home delivery fleet is expected to cover up to 75,000 miles a year.

The company has also ordered 71 spare de-mount boxes, as part of a trial to optimise its warehouse and delivery operations. It means freestanding boxes can be pre-loaded in the warehouse for both brands, while vehicles are on the road making deliveries. De-mount boxes can be swapped directly at out-base locations.

Steinhoff supply chain and logistics director Kalwant Singh said: “The de-mountable bodies allow us to utilise the warehouse teams over a 24-hour window, pre-loading boxes for trunking and delivery to our out-base locations.”
